To thrive as an Over The Road (OTR) Class B driver, you need a valid Class B Commercial Driver’s License (CDL), a clean driving record, and a strong understanding of traffic laws and safety regulations. Experience with electronic logging devices (ELDs), GPS navigation, and proper cargo securing systems is typically required. Dependability, strong communication, and time management skills are valued soft skills for coordinating deliveries and handling long-distance routes. These qualifications ensure safe, timely, and efficient transport of goods over regional or long-haul routes.
